Technische Universit盲t M眉nchen (TUM)
As the number one university in Germany, TUM is a leading institution in engineering, natural sciences, and life sciences. Located in Munich, the university boasts state-of-the-art facilities and a vibrant campus life. TUM offers a wide range of undergraduate and graduate programs, with a strong emphasis on interdisciplinary research. Some of the most popular programs include m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, and computer science.
Heidelberg University
Heidelberg University, founded in 1386, is one of the oldest universities in Germany. It is known for its strong focus on the humanities, natural sciences, and medicine. The university offers a variety of undergraduate and graduate programs, with a particular strength in the fields of philosophy, history, and chemistry. Heidelberg’s beautiful campus, located in the heart of the city, is another draw for students.

University of Freiburg
University of Freiburg is a public research university located in Freiburg, Germany. It is known for its strong focus on sustainability and environmental research. The university offers a wide range of undergraduate and graduate programs, with a particular strength in the fields of natural sciences, engineering, and medicine. Freiburg’s picturesque campus, surrounded by the Black Forest, is another reason why students choose to study here.
University of Cologne
University of Cologne is a public research university located in Cologne, Germany. It is known for its strong focus on the humanities, social sciences, and natural sciences. The university offers a variety of undergraduate and graduate programs, with a particular strength in the fields of economics, law, and philosophy. Cologne’s vibrant city life and its historic architecture make it an attractive destination for students.
